What is the difference in iPod Touch generations?

The iPod touch 6th Gen models are model number A1574 whereas the iPod touch 7th Gen models are A2178. The iPod touch 7th Gen models, on the other hand, have a much faster dual-core 64-bit 1.6 GHz A10 Fusion processor and 2 GB of RAM. They are available with 32 GB, 128 GB, or 256 GB of storage.

Are there different colors of iPod Touch 5?

The final entry-level 16 GB and original 32 GB and 64 GB configurations of the iPod touch 5th Gen were available in six different colors — gray (originally a dark gray “slate” and medium toned gunmetal “space gray” starting September 10, 2013), silver, pink, yellow, blue, and red.

How to tell the difference between iPod Touch 6 and 7?

Neither line has “Touch ID” or “Face ID” for authentication. The iPod touch 6th Gen and iPod touch 7th Gen models cannot be differentiated by appearance even when side-by-side. However, it is possible to externally identify the iPod touch 6th Gen and 7th Gen models by the Model Number in small type on the back of each device toward the bottom.

What kind of processor does the iPod Touch 6 have?

The iPod touch 6th Gen models, have a dual-core 64-bit 1.1 GHz A8 processor as well as an M8 motion coprocessor and 1 GB of RAM. Storage options originally were 16 GB, 32 GB, 64 GB, and 128 GB, but later were pared to 32 GB and 128 GB.
